🧡Self-Love Is the Best Love🧡

In a world that constantly tells us to seek validation from others, it’s easy to forget the most important relationship we’ll ever have—the one with ourselves.
Loving yourself means:
✨ Setting boundaries that protect your peace.
✨ Speaking to yourself with kindness and compassion.
✨ Prioritising your mental and physical well-being.
✨ Letting go of past mistakes and allowing yourself to grow.
✨ Choosing relationships that uplift and respect you.

The way you treat yourself sets the standard for how others treat you. When you embrace self-love, you no longer search for fulfillment in external validation—you become your own source of happiness, confidence, and strength.

Remember you are worthy of love, exactly as you are. Start by giving it to yourself first. ❤️

Mental health is important because it affects how we think, feel, and behave in daily life. It influences how we handle stress, relate to others, and make decisions. Good mental health helps us cope with challenges, maintain healthy relationships, and achieve our goals.

When mental health is neglected, it can lead to issues like anxiety, depression, increased stress and burnout or even physical health problems. Prioritising mental well-being through self-care, therapy, and support systems can improve our overall quality of life and help us function at our best.

Hope is an essential aspect of our mental health. It is the belief that things can get better and that we have the ability to make positive changes in our lives. Without hope, it can be difficult to find the motivation and drive to work through difficult situations and overcome challenges.

Hope can provide a sense of direction and purpose, even in the darkest of times. It allows us to see that there is light at the end of the tunnel and that there is a way out of our struggles. It gives us the courage to take action and make positive changes, even when it feels impossible to face our fears.

It is important to remember that hope is not just about positive thinking or ignoring reality. It is about seeing the reality of our situation and believing that we can make positive changes, even in the face of difficult circumstances. It is about having the courage to take action and make the necessary changes in order to improve our mental health and wellbeing.

So this year, choose Hope. Keep hope alive and know that things can and will always get better. ❤️

Why Happiness Blooms When We Stop Comparing

The carefully curated squares of Instagram, the meticulously crafted tweets, the seemingly perfect lives documented on Facebook - social media can be a breeding ground for comparison. We scroll through feeds, bombarded by achievements, vacations, and milestones, and a nagging question creeps in: "Why isn't my life like that?"

But here's the truth: social media is a highlight reel, not reality. It's easy to get caught up in the comparison trap, constantly measuring our own progress against the carefully constructed narratives of others. This relentless comparison breeds envy, dissatisfaction, and ultimately, steals our joy.

So, how do we break free and cultivate happiness that stems from within? Here are a few tips:
🌻Focus on your journey, not the destination. Social media loves showcasing the "after" photos, the finished products, the mountain peaks. But every accomplishment has a journey, filled with struggles, setbacks, and lessons learned. Celebrate your own progress, big or small.
🌻Embrace your individuality. We all have unique strengths, passions, and goals. Chasing someone else's dream will never bring you true fulfillment. Spend time reflecting on what truly matters to you and dedicate your energy to building your own path.
🌹Practice gratitude. Take a moment each day to appreciate the good things in your life, big or small. Gratitude shifts your focus from what's lacking to the abundance that already surrounds you.
🌹Curate your online space. Just like you wouldn't decorate your living room with someone else's furniture, don't fill your social media with content that makes you feel inadequate. Follow accounts that inspire you, motivate you, or simply bring you joy.

Choose You, Ditch the Guilt: Why Self-Care Isn't Selfish!
We've all been there: the internal struggle when prioritising ourselves. Maybe it's saying no to extra work, taking a mental health day, or pursuing a long-held dream. Suddenly, a familiar voice whispers, "You're being selfish!"

But here's the truth: choosing yourself is not selfish. It's essential. Here's why prioritising yourself is the key to a happier, healthier you:

❤️Replenished Energy: By taking care of your physical and mental well-being, you have more energy and enthusiasm to contribute to your work, relationships, and passions.
❤️Stronger Boundaries: When you prioritise your needs, you set healthy boundaries. This allows you to say no without guilt and build more fulfilling connections.
❤️Reduced Stress: Guilt takes a toll. Choosing yourself reduces stress and allows you to show up as your best self in all areas of life.
❤️Clearer Vision: When your needs are met, you gain a clearer perspective on your goals and aspirations. This empowers you to make choices that truly align with your values.

✨️Practice Self-Compassion: Be kind to yourself. We all deserve to prioritise our well-being.
✨️Communicate Openly: Let loved ones know your needs. True friends and family will support your self-care journey.
✨️Celebrate Your Wins: Acknowledge and celebrate your progress in prioritising yourself.
✨️Start Small: Don't overwhelm yourself. Begin with small acts of self-care, like taking a relaxing bath or reading a good book.

💕Remember: Choosing yourself is not a luxury. It's a necessity. By prioritising your well-being, you create a ripple effect of positivity in your life and the lives of those around you. So ditch the guilt, embrace self-care, and watch yourself blossom!💕
